The winter edition of the Retrochallenge competition will be held from 1-12-2014 until 31-1-2015. Everybody with a retro computer project can compete. Examples of the entries are: Urbancamo – KIM Uno with keypad, Michael Sternberg – Serial port, Eric Smith – Restoration of a 1976 computer, Paleoferrosaurus – Building a classic computer from junk hardware. Kevin Smallwood announced in the Facebook Apple II Enthusiasts forum that he intends to release the GBBSPro bulletin board system (along with ACOS and other related products) under the GPL. Kevin is the current owner of the GBBSPro product. Tony Diaz has a huge collection of GBBSPro/ACOS material, so in tandem, they will be releasing a literal treasure trove of…

C64.com has published an interview with Matt Gray, the great Commodore 64 SID composer (Last Ninja 2)! Matt is also running a Kickstarter campaign “Reformation C64 Track Remakes”, which has reached (and passed) its goal already. You can read the interview following the link below.
